Indragiri River is inhabited by many typs of gastropod. A research aims to understand the community structure of the gastropod in that river has been conducted in June-July 2018. There were 3 stations, the river bank far away from inhabitants settlement (Station 1), at the small island in the river center (Station 2), the river bank near from inhabitants activity (Station 3) and in each stations there were 3 quadrant point. Gastropods and water were sampled 3 times, once/week. The gastropods collected by hand and were preserved by formalin 10%. Parameters measured were the abundance, diversity index, dominance index and uniformity index of the gastropod. Water quality parameters measured were temperature, current speed, depth, pH and dissolved oxygen. Results shown that there were 5 gastropods spesies present, namely Brotia testudinaria, Melanoids granifera, Melanoides tuberculata, Thiara scabra and Bellamya sp. The density of gastropod ranged from 15 to 21 organisms/m2, diversity index was 1.763 to 2.199, dominance index was 0.230 to 0.325 and uniformity index was 0.882 to 0.947. The water quality parameter values were as follow : temperature 29 to 300C, current speed 15.18 to 24.91 cm/second, depth 12.2 to 20.5 cm, pH 6 and dissolved oxygen 8.59 to 9.75 mg/L. Data obtained indicate that the water of the Indragiri River is moderately polluted.Keywords : Mollusca, Brotia sp, River Ecosystem, Lubuk Terentang Village
